
Message from Michael Feist "Measured by quantity of translations, this work is the most successful publication of the Witte-Verlag Publishing. It was translated into Thai, Latvian, Russian, Japanese, Estonian and English. So it became a worldwide standard work about Uranian System of Astrology (System Hamburger Schule) for the meaning of the Planets (Factors) and the Uranian Houses."
